Carolyn Louise Butler-Rufus was born on January 30, 1948, in Ethel, Arkansas, to
William and Evangelyn Butler. She departed this life on December 12, 2024, leaving
behind a legacy of love and service.
Carolyn enjoyed a distinguished career at Blue Cross Blue Shield, where she dedicated
43 years of faithful service, earning the esteem and admiration of her colleagues. Her
commitment to her work reflected her strong work ethic and determination.
Beyond her professional accomplishments, Carolyn was a devoted servant of God. For
over 40 years, she faithfully served at Longley Baptist Church, where she made a
profound impact on her community through her unwavering faith and compassionate
spirit. Her contributions to the church and the lives she touched through her ministry are
a testament to her character and devotion.
Carolyn will be remembered for her kindness, generosity, and the love she shared with
family and friends. Her unwavering faith and commitment to serving others have left an
indelible mark on all who knew her. She will be dearly missed and lovingly remembered.
